ISCDD Annual Meeting 2025: Advancing CNS Drug Development

 

Overview

 

The International Society for CNS Drug Development (ISCDD) Annual Meeting 2025 will be held from March 19 to March 21 in Las Vegas, USA. This pivotal event gathers researchers, clinicians, and industry leaders dedicated to improving methodologies and addressing scientific challenges in CNS drug development.

GRID-Hamilton Depression Rating Scale (GRID-HAMD) Special attention will be given to the GRID-Hamilton Depression Rating Scale (GRID-HAMD), an improved version of the Hamilton Depression Rating Scale developed through international consensus. Discussions will focus on its application in clinical research and its role in enhancing the assessment of depression severity and treatment outcomes.
